Output 525ba318b08c0a87867c125ced3b62e508dc1303e18039ce600fef2fff16a1ab:0

value
39000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8acd3ec52973f031b04e0663037be9e113d65b69 OP_EQUALVERIFY OP_CHECKSIG
address
1Dev8ADGYuX2eUjxSnmZPDpsAeSiUHTBzD
transaction
525ba318b08c0a87867c125ced3b62e508dc1303e18039ce600fef2fff16a1ab
spent
true